It is the purpose of this ordinance to promote the public health, safety, and general welfare, and to minimize the degradation of the water quality in receiving waters of the city's storm drainage system caused by discharges of contaminants into this system by provisions designed to:
Control discharges associated with industrial activity and stormwater quality discharged from sites of industrial activity
Control spills, dumping, or disposal of materials other than stormwater to the city's storm drainage system
Enable the city to comply with all federal and state laws and regulations applicable to stormwater discharges
Encourage recycling of used motor oil and safe disposal of hazardous consumer products
Establish authority and penalties to insure compliance with conditions of this article
Establish the authority for the city to carry out inspections, surveillance, and monitoring procedures necessary to determine compliance and noncompliance with EPA, state, and city regulations concerning stormwater quality, prohibition of pollution, and illicit discharges to the city's storm drainage system
Facilitate compliance with state and federal standards and permits by owners and operators of industrial and construction sites within the city
Prohibit illicit discharges to the city's storm drainage system
Promote public awareness of the hazards involved in the improper disposal of:
Fertilizers
Herbicides
Household hazardous waste
Industrial waste
Pesticides
Petroleum products
Sediment from construction sites
Other contaminants into the city's storm drainage system
